What Exactly Is a 2000 Chevy Cavalier Stereo Wiring Diagram?
A 2000 Chevy Cavalier Stereo Wiring Diagram is essentially a visual blueprint that maps out all the electrical connections for your car's audio system. It shows you where each wire originates, where it needs to go, and what its function is. Think of it as the electrical roadmap for your car's sound. Without this diagram, attempting to install or modify your stereo would be like trying to navigate a new city without a map. The importance of a clear and accurate wiring diagram cannot be overstated for a successful and safe installation. These diagrams are vital for several reasons. They help you identify specific wires for functions like power, ground, illumination, and speaker outputs. For instance, you'll see which wire provides constant power (always on, even when the car is off), which provides ignition power (only on when the car is running), and which handles the signal to each speaker.
